Position: Director, Practice Development


We represent a national wealth management firm seeking a leader to develop and expand their advisor practice management, business development, succession planning, and financial planning offerings. Position is based in San Diego.


Key Responsibilities:


  • Oversee the strategic development/tactical execution of firm's practice development initiatives.
  • Develop a centralized financial planning offering for their Advisors.
  • Leverage data intelligence with Advisors to show them their next best action for organic growth.
  • Maintain and develop new practice development content for advisor-facing intranet website.
  • Maintain existing coaching partner relationships and develop new relationships as appropriate.
  • Create monthly advisor articles with sales ideas or education related to practice development.
  • Evaluate and deliver new value-added tools, resources, or partner relationships to support the sales and servicing activities of their advisors.
  • Consult with advisors on practice development issues - succession planning, practice valuations, staffing/hiring/compensation, marketing strategies, and more.
  • Keep current on industry trends and best practices through attendance at industry conferences, webinar participation, white papers etc.
  • Maintain ongoing and effective communications with key constituency groups including the Managing Directors, department heads, and other individuals considered to be key internal stakeholders.
  • Serve as a strategic thinker and leader within the broader organization.

Qualifications


  • Bachelor's Degree required.
  • Minimum five years of experience in the practice management industry, preferably with an independent broker/dealer.
  • Prior experience with buying and selling financial advisory practices including familiarity with valuation methodologies, financing, and contracts/agreements (preferred).
  • FINRA Series 6 and 63 licenses are required; Series 7, 65, and 66 are a plus.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to engage stakeholders at all levels. Public speaking experience is a plus.
  • Knowledge of issues impacting independent financial advisors, including marketing, operations, staffing, and profitability metrics.
  • Strong knowledge of advisor segmentation strategies and client service models to drive client satisfaction and business growth.
